小红花·文摘
  • 首页
  • 广场
  • 排行榜🏆
  • 直播
  • FAQ
Dify.AI
如何在Flutter中使用Mixins [完整手册]

Flutter开发者常面临代码重复的问题,尤其在动画处理上。由于Dart不支持多重继承,开发者往往需要复制粘贴相同逻辑,增加维护难度和错误风险。Mixins提供了解决方案,允许开发者模块化功能,避免代码重复。通过mixins,开发者可以在不同类中复用相同逻辑,而无需建立父子关系。本文探讨了mixins的概念、使用方法及其在Flutter中的应用,帮助开发者更有效管理代码。

如何在Flutter中使用Mixins [完整手册]

freeCodeCamp.org
freeCodeCamp.org · 2026-04-13T21:53:39Z
通过我的猫Oreo理解JavaScript混入

Oreo是一只具有身份危机的猫,既是捕食者又是专业的睡觉者。JavaScript中的mixins允许将一个对象的方法和属性添加到另一个对象,避免多重继承。通过mixins,Oreo可以同时具备“猫”和“打盹大师”等多种行为,广泛应用于UI组件、API客户端和游戏开发中,提供灵活的行为共享方式。

通过我的猫Oreo理解JavaScript混入

DEV Community
DEV Community · 2025-05-16T21:32:31Z
SASS中的Mixins

Mixins 是 CSS 预处理器中的工具,用于代码重用。通过 mixin,可以自动生成多个类,如 font-size 类。利用 map 和循环,可以轻松创建从 fs-1 到 fs-100 的类,简化代码,提高效率。

SASS中的Mixins

DEV Community
DEV Community · 2024-11-08T16:57:57Z

在面向对象编程中,Mixin是一种通过委托为类添加功能的方法。Kotlin中,Mixin通过接口和委托实现,支持多重继承,提升代码复用性。尽管有方法公开的限制,Mixin仍然是值得探索的工具。

Utilisation des Mixins (ou Traits) en Kotlin avec la Délégation

DEV Community
DEV Community · 2024-10-18T11:05:52Z

文章介绍了一些实用的SASS mixins和函数,如像素转rem、响应式媒体查询、z-index管理、缓存破坏背景图像和字体、绝对定位、文本省略和悬停效果。这些工具帮助开发者实现响应式设计、层次布局和代码复用,提高效率。

使用这些SASS Mixins和函数最大化您的工作流程

DEV Community
DEV Community · 2024-10-10T14:55:05Z
freeCodeCamp | Front End Development Libraries | 笔记

本文介绍了使用Sass变量、嵌套CSS、Mixins、@if和@else、@for、@each、@while、Partials、@extend、React渲染方法、高级JavaScript、&&、三元表达式、唯一的key属性、Array.map()、Array.filter()、Object.assign、删除数组项、展开运算符、常量Action类型、store侦听器、中间件、Redux计数器、不可变state、Provider、state映射到props等内容。

freeCodeCamp | Front End Development Libraries | 笔记

yiyun's Blog
yiyun's Blog · 2023-06-14T14:04:52Z

一直以来,我都没有使用过 Mixins 这个功能,因为一直以来,我都会倾向于在不同的页面承载不同的功能。 但最 […]

用好 Mixins

西秦公子
西秦公子 · 2021-03-11T13:01:58Z
  • <<
  • <
  • 1 (current)
  • >
  • >>
👤 个人中心
在公众号发送验证码完成验证
登录验证
在本设备完成一次验证即可继续使用

完成下面两步后,将自动完成登录并继续当前操作。

1 关注公众号
小红花技术领袖公众号二维码
小红花技术领袖
如果当前 App 无法识别二维码,请在微信搜索并关注该公众号
2 发送验证码
在公众号对话中发送下面 4 位验证码
小红花技术领袖俱乐部
小红花·文摘:汇聚分发优质内容
小红花技术领袖俱乐部
Copyright © 2021-
粤ICP备2022094092号-1
公众号 小红花技术领袖俱乐部公众号二维码
视频号 小红花技术领袖俱乐部视频号二维码